Board denies Fresh Start preapproval for incarcerated applicant with violent convictions
Summary
The Board of Licensing Contractors denied a Fresh Start preapproval request for Michael Rico, citing statutory factors relating to the nature of his convictions and lack of demonstrated rehabilitation; the board instructed staff to send a written denial and recorded that the applicant may reapply upon release from incarceration.
The Board of Licensing Contractors voted May 20 to deny a Fresh Start preapproval for an applicant identified in the record as Michael Rico. Staff told the board Rico is currently incarcerated with a release date noted in the record as 2034 and has two felony convictions the board described in its discussion as involving a child and an aggravated assault offense.
